What people on the ground measured in Bossier City, LA on May 22, 2024
6 reports filed with the National Weather Service — 1 from trained spotters or officials. These are measured stones, not radar estimates, so they are the closest thing to proof that hail actually reached the ground.
- 2.00″ hen egg size Law Enforcement4 SSW Shreveport, LA · 8.0 mi away7:00 PM CDTCaddo County
Sheriff office sent photo of hail near Meriwether and Walker Road intersection.
- 1.75″ golf ball size Public3 S Shreveport, LA · 7.4 mi away7:01 PM CDTCaddo County
Reported just north of intersection of Mansfield Road Inner Loop 3132.
- 1.75″ golf ball size Public6 S Shreveport, LA · 9.5 mi away6:59 PM CDTCaddo County
Reported in Chasewood Subdivision.
- 1.75″ golf ball size CO-OP Observer6 S Shreveport, LA · 10.2 mi away7:03 PM CDTCaddo County
Large hail reported in Deepwoods Subdivision. Also, estimated 60 mph winds.
- 1.00″ quarter size NWS Employee6 S Barksdale Air Force, LA · 7.7 mi away7:08 PM CDTCaddo County
Reported off of Youree Drive near Stratmore Drive in southeast Shreveport.
- 1.00″ quarter size CO-OP Observer6 S Shreveport, LA · 10.2 mi away6:48 PM CDTCaddo County
Reported in the Deepwoods Subdivision.
Reports come from the National Weather Service Local Storm Report feed, ingested every 15 minutes. A report records where the observer was, not the full extent of the swath — treat it as evidence about the storm, not about any one roof.
